Lincoln-Hancock Pool

325 Water St, Quincy, MA 02169, USA

Quincy, MA 02169

Phone: (617) 376-1394

Hours

Mon Closed
Tue Closed
Wed Closed
Thu Closed
Fri Open 24 hours
Sat Closed
Sun Open 24 hours
family fun